Gaji
| Pengalaman | Tahunan (CAD) | |
|---|---|---|
| Pemula (0-3 tahun) | $30,000 ~ $40,000 | Hourly wage approximately CAD 15-20 |
| Menengah (3-6 tahun) | $40,000 ~ $55,000 | Hourly wage approximately $20-27 CAD |
| Senior (6+ years) | $55,000 ~ $70,000 | Including supervisor or technician positions |

Migrasi
Occupation classification code: 85121(NOC)
⚠ Direct Express Entry may be unavailable for this occupation, but migration is possible via employer sponsorship (LMIA work permit) or a Provincial Nominee Program (PNP) — pathways and places are limited. Refer to the latest IRCC rules.
| Visa | Detail |
|---|---|
| PNP Provincial Nominee Program | Provincial nominee programs in several provinces (e.g., Saskatchewan, Manitoba, BC) are open to landscapers, requiring employer sponsorship |
| TFWP Temporary Foreign Worker Program | Employers can apply for a Labour Market Impact Assessment (LMIA) to hire foreign landscapers; after one year of work, they can apply for immigration |
| EE Express Entry | Those with management experience may apply through Federal Skilled Migration or Experience Class, but general gardeners typically do not meet direct eligibility criteria. |

Prospek karir
Landscapers can progress from entry-level workers to landscape technicians, project managers, or self-employment. With experience, they can expand their career by obtaining certifications (e.g., landscape designer).
With urbanization and increasing demand for aesthetically pleasing environments, the employment outlook for landscapers in Canada is stable. The construction and property maintenance industries continue to grow, but competition is low and entry barriers are modest.
